概括
呈现一种罕见的急性B型主动脉解剖病例,也称为内壁血瘤,由上层中枢动脉动脉瘤复杂化. 共同的潜在原因可能会将这两种严重的血管疾病联系在一起.

Once the aorta traverses the diaphragmatic plane at the aortic hiatus, it is known as the abdominal aorta. This anatomical structure is positioned leftward of the spinal column, encased within a cocoon of adipose tissue behind the peritoneal cavity. It terminates at the L4 vertebra, where it splits into the common iliac arteries. Prior to this bifurcation, the abdominal aorta gives rise to several vital branches.
